Harp Program

The School offers a program of harp study for the early beginner through the advanced high school student, beginning at age four or older. The inclusive philosophy of Angela Diller and Elizabeth Quaile, as well as traditional harp pedagogies, informs an approach that assures teaching tailored to the needs of the individual student, with a strong emphasis on building confident solo performing, fluent music reading, and skillful ensemble participation. Both in-person and remote programs are available for harp study.

HARP ENSEMBLE

Harp students explore score reading and ensemble playing in ensembles of two to four players, which meet weekly throughout the school year. Ensembles study a wide range of repertoire and are shaped according to level. Placement auditions are held in the spring for returning students and during interviews for new students.
